Output 3af245895fb8564be0ed164f39067cc43ea2dec14f5529a5c557f5428de7ad07:1

value
6611871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 252ae91d20364d072bf9eb287fada8d95f07e049 OP_EQUAL
address
MBHge1TaWNmpMCB1eQY2s5HB9NLQtfJhc3
transaction
3af245895fb8564be0ed164f39067cc43ea2dec14f5529a5c557f5428de7ad07
spent
true